I accidentally created Microsoft 365 Business using a personal Microsoft account. I’m getting AADSTS165000 and can’t sign in.

    If you accidentally created a Microsoft 365 Business account using a personal Microsoft account and are encountering the AADSTS165000 error, it typically indicates that there is an issue with the account type or credentials being used to sign in. Here are some steps you can take to resolve this issue:

    1. Verify Account Type: Ensure that you are using the correct account type to sign in. If you created the account with a personal Microsoft account, you may need to switch to a work or school account if applicable.
    2. Check Credentials: Double-check that you are entering the correct email address and password associated with the Microsoft 365 Business account. Make sure there are no typos and that you are not inadvertently using credentials from a different account.
    3. Contact Support: If you continue to experience issues, consider reaching out to Microsoft support for assistance. They can help you verify the account and resolve any sign-in problems.
    4. Use Self-Service Password Reset: If you suspect that you might have forgotten your password, you can use the Self-Service Password Reset wizard to reset your password if you have the necessary permissions.

    Following these steps should help you address the sign-in issue related to your Microsoft 365 Business account.
